Transaction 11d96b314de91cc23ee639348144143826264775e71abe370f18fce4122c88c2
1 Input
2 Outputs
- 11d96b314de91cc23ee639348144143826264775e71abe370f18fce4122c88c2:0
- 11d96b314de91cc23ee639348144143826264775e71abe370f18fce4122c88c2:1
value 160000
address 38AnuugD6J6h3icyLxnbt3EHuHd9eHsDzj
value 670621
address 1QCmHisoQ2GkrK7V1PxVTmXgvh4pjJXBnZ